WASHINGTON — Former Vice President Mike Pence said Friday that he would not endorse his former boss as Trump seeks another term in office.

“I will not be endorsing Donald Trump this year,” Pence said on Fox News.

The startling announcement came as Trump secured enough Republican delegates this week to clinch the party’s nomination.
